Docjar: A Java Source and Docuemnt Enginecom.*    java.*    javax.*    org.*    all    new    plug-in

Quick Search    Search Deep

org.livingpaper.hansa
Class HansaMap  view HansaMap download HansaMap.java

java.lang.Object
  extended byorg.livingpaper.hansa.HansaMap

public class HansaMap
extends java.lang.Object


Field Summary
 java.util.Vector mCities
           
private  java.awt.Rectangle mSearchRect
           
 
Constructor Summary
HansaMap(java.lang.String dataPath)
           
 
Method Summary
 City cityAt(java.awt.Point pt, int hysteresis)
           
private  void ensureCities()
           
 java.util.Enumeration enumerateCities()
           
 java.util.Vector getCities()
           
 City getCityByName(java.lang.String cityName)
           
 java.io.File getCityDataFile(java.lang.String path)
           
 java.util.Vector getCityNames()
           
 void initCitiesFromFile(java.io.File dataFile)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

mCities

public java.util.Vector mCities

mSearchRect

private java.awt.Rectangle mSearchRect
Constructor Detail

HansaMap

public HansaMap(java.lang.String dataPath)
Method Detail

initCitiesFromFile

public void initCitiesFromFile(java.io.File dataFile)

ensureCities

private void ensureCities()

getCityDataFile

public java.io.File getCityDataFile(java.lang.String path)
                             throws java.security.InvalidParameterException

enumerateCities

public java.util.Enumeration enumerateCities()

getCities

public java.util.Vector getCities()

getCityNames

public java.util.Vector getCityNames()

getCityByName

public City getCityByName(java.lang.String cityName)

cityAt

public City cityAt(java.awt.Point pt,
                   int hysteresis)